Household of Tannetje Stroo

She is married to Johannes Kornelis Melse.

They got married on May 3, 1929 at Biggekerke, she was 24 years old.

Gemeente : Biggekerke
Aktenummer (number) : 5
Aktedatum (date) : 03-05-1929
BRUIDEGOM : Johannes Kornelis Melse
Leeftijd (age) : 25 jaar
Geboorteplaats (place of birth) : Meliskerke
Beroep (occupation) : Grondwerker
BRUID : Tannetje Stroo
Leeftijd (age) : 24 jaar
Geboorteplaats (place of birth) : Biggekerke
Beroep (occupation) : Zonder
VADER BRUIDEGOM (father bridegroom) : Leijn Melse
MOEDER BRUIDEGOM (mother bridegroom) : Sina Minderhoud
Beroep (occupation) : Zonder
VADER BRUID (father bride) : Simon Stroo
Beroep (occupation) : Landbouwer
MOEDER BRUID (mother bride) : Adriana Coppoolse
